Mission
The mission of the Washington Office for Advocacy is to influence public policy decisions made by the U.S. Congress and Administration on issues of concern to the Unitarian Universalist Association (UUA). The Office also provides support and resources to congregations and individuals seeking to create change in their communities and states.
The Washington Office also sponsors a Social Justice Internship Program in which Unitarian Universalists have the opportunity to expand their advocacy skills, grow personally, and acquire professional experience while serving the interests of the UUA.
